This modern terraced house is offered for sale with no forward chain. It is set within Donnington, on the southern fringe of Chichester.
The accommodation includes an entrance hall, a kitchen / breakfast room and a reception room with sliding patio doors to a part covered terrace. The reception room has a fireplace which is currently boarded. Upstairs there are two good size double bedrooms, a single bedroom and a family bathroom with a mains shower over the bath.
The garden is to the rear, as is the main entrance to the property. There is a small patio and some flowerbeds. There is a single garage and ample off road parking.

Donnington, with its parade of local shops, lies approximately one mile to the south of Chichester city centre. The cathedral city of Chichester offers excellent high street shopping, many fashionable restaurants, cafes and bars, Festival Theatre and a mainline station to London Victoria. Goodwood is famous for its many event days including the world renowned Festival of Speed and Goodwood Revival for motor racing enthusiasts and a season of horse racing including the Qatar Goodwood Festival. There are excellent sailing facilities around Chichester Harbour and windsurfing from the beaches at West Wittering. The area is a paradise for wildlife enthusiasts, with beautiful walks and cycle tracks over the South Downs and around the harbour.
